How much do weekend commercial bakery j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 10, 2026, the average hourly pay for weekend commercial bakery in the United States is $22.85,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$19.23 and $24.52 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Weekend Commercial Bakery vs Weekend Pastry Chef?

AspectWeekend Commercial BakeryWeekend Pastry Chef
CredentialsFood safety certifications, baking experiencePastry arts certification, culinary training
Work EnvironmentCommercial bakery setting, production linesBakery or restaurant kitchen, creative space
Employer & IndustryBakery chains, food production companiesRestaurants, hotels, boutique bakeries

Weekend Commercial Bakers focus on large-scale production, adhering to safety standards, while Weekend Pastry Chefs emphasize creative pastry work and menu development. Both roles require baking skills but differ in environment and scope of work.

Do weekend commercial bakers work on weekends?

Weekend commercial bakers typically work on weekends as part of their scheduled shifts, especially in bakeries that operate seven days a week. Their schedules often include early mornings, evenings, or overnight hours to meet production demands. Flexibility and availability on weekends are common requirements for this role.

Job description

Summary/Objective

The role of a Production Team Member assists the Baker in the process and baking of pita bread for Sara’s Market & Bakery brand.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Assist Baker in weighing, measuring, mixing, baking following Sara’s Market & Bakery recipe
  • Assist Baker in ensuring temperatures inside building are optimal for proofing and baking dough
  • Assist Baker in making supply and ingredient orders
  • Ensure quality and freshness of product and communicate any issues to Store Leadership.
  • Inform Baker of any issues of the pita line not working properly.
  • Follow and comply with all applicable procedures and regulations, including Weights and Measures, FDA, health and sanitation, Department of Labor, ADA, HAACP, OSHA and safe work practices.
  • Operate and sanitize all equipment in a safe and proper manner.
  • Leadership may assign other duties, not listed here.

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ities

  • Ability to work in fast paced environment with a sense of urgency
  • Strong organizational skills
  • Ability to perform physical requirements of position
  • Ability to work well with others
  • Strong written and verbal skills
  • Ability to inspect product for quality and freshness
  • Basic computer skills
  • Able to handle stressful situations
  • Values diversity
  • Able to work flexible schedule based on needs of store including nights, weekends and holidays

Qualifications

  • 3+ years working  for Commercial bakery business
  • Guest Service focused
  • Team oriented
  • Food Handler Permit

Working Conditions

  • Walking, standing, bending and stooping for 8-10 hours a day
  • Push, pull up to 50lbs
  • Mental and physical dexterity
  • Ability to climb ladders
  • Iteration of duties
  • Ability to taste, smell, feel and visually inspect food
  • Unassisted lifting up to 50lbs or more
  • Work in varying temperatures
